Brand: Technics

The Technics EPC-100C is an electronic phonograph cartridge that was produced by the Japanese audio equipment manufacturer, Panasonic (formerly known as Matsushita Electric Industrial Co. Ltd.) in the 1990s. It is a high-performance cartridge designed for use with turntables, specifically the Technics SL-1000C. The EPC-100C features a low-output moving-magnet (MM) design, with a built-in capacitor that requires a step-up transformer in the phono stage to boost the signals for optimal performance when connected to an amplifier or preamp that does not have a built-in transformer. Overall, the Technics EPC-100C is a reliable and affordable cartridge that offers high-fidelity sound, particularly in the midrange and lower frequencies.
